Vtech Touch and Swipe Baby Phone Power Switch Replacement

Was du brauchst

  1. Vtech Touch and Swipe Baby Phone Power Switch Replacement, Battery: Schritt 1, Bild 1 von 2 Vtech Touch and Swipe Baby Phone Power Switch Replacement, Battery: Schritt 1, Bild 2 von 2
    • Using a Phillips #1 screwdriver, remove the 4.8mm screw on the battery cover by twisting the screwdriver counter-clockwise.

  2. Vtech Touch and Swipe Baby Phone Power Switch Replacement: Schritt 2, Bild 1 von 3 Vtech Touch and Swipe Baby Phone Power Switch Replacement: Schritt 2, Bild 2 von 3 Vtech Touch and Swipe Baby Phone Power Switch Replacement: Schritt 2, Bild 3 von 3
    • Remove the two AAA batteries by pulling on one end of the battery and lifting it straight out.

  3. Vtech Touch and Swipe Baby Phone Power Switch Replacement: Schritt 3, Bild 1 von 3 Vtech Touch and Swipe Baby Phone Power Switch Replacement: Schritt 3, Bild 2 von 3 Vtech Touch and Swipe Baby Phone Power Switch Replacement: Schritt 3, Bild 3 von 3
    • When reassembling, align the notch on the battery panel with the slot on the phone.

  4. Vtech Touch and Swipe Baby Phone Power Switch Replacement, Power Switch: Schritt 4, Bild 1 von 2 Vtech Touch and Swipe Baby Phone Power Switch Replacement, Power Switch: Schritt 4, Bild 2 von 2
    • Remove 4 13.8mm screws holding the device back using a Phillips #1 screw driver.

  5. Vtech Touch and Swipe Baby Phone Power Switch Replacement: Schritt 5, Bild 1 von 3 Vtech Touch and Swipe Baby Phone Power Switch Replacement: Schritt 5, Bild 2 von 3 Vtech Touch and Swipe Baby Phone Power Switch Replacement: Schritt 5, Bild 3 von 3
    • Lift directly up to remove the switch and lay the wire down to the side.

    • Once the switch has been taken out you can remove the switch's casing.

Abschluss

To reassemble your device, follow these instructions in reverse order.
